Break-glass is reserved for incidents where the dedup merge queue is corrupting golden records and normal RBAC escalation is unavailable. Invoking break-glass is logged immutably and pages the on-call security reviewer automatically. The operator must open the sealed escrow envelope, authenticate at the Mergeline admin console, and, when the console presents the escrow challenge, enter the recovery passphrase exactly as recorded below.

unlock words, hahip-baduf: holwyn-istath-julvan

**TICKET DV-188: diff viewer env broken on staging**

For weekly sync: the Splitpane large-file diff viewer fails on staging because `CHUNK_LIMIT_MB` was set to 4 instead of 64, so anything over that renders blank. Fixed in the Norwick overlay; prod unaffected. Staging also lost its blob-store credential during the env rebuild — restore it by adding the line immediately below.

vault entry, yahif-yajep: COURIER_KEY29=b802bdf8034096b65a51c6ba5abe2

# Environment for the Quillhaven asset pipeline.
#
# We vendor all third-party fonts into assets/fonts rather than fetching
# them at build time; this keeps builds reproducible and avoids breakage
# when upstream foundries reorganize their catalogs. If you add a font,
# record its license in LICENSES-fonts.md and pin the exact file hash in
# fonts.lock. The vendoring script verifies hashes before packaging and
# needs authenticated access to the Marrowtype mirror to pull updates.
# That access is granted by the credential on the next line:

vault entry, yajop-bafop: ARCHIVE_KEY3=8d4

To all branch managers of Torvald & Mace: effective the first of next quarter, the sales-commission scheme is revised. Standard rates hold at current levels, but the threshold for accelerated payout moves from 100% to 105% of target, and split-credit rules now apply to the Ashgrove product family. Updated calculators will be distributed through regional coordinators. Direct questions to your district lead during the transition window. A confidential note on related business plans appears directly below.

confidential, kagep-kahof: Druokax Systems plans to lower the Ulaath list price by 53 percent in March.